After finishing a few tutorials, i thought i was ready to calculate the pixel values of a large smaller numbers 20x20 used here image and export to a standard format. You also learned about the three dimensions of an image width, height, and bit depth. Pixel inspection tool national institutes of health. When you create and export pixel labels from the image labeler, video labeler, or ground truth labeler requires. Use image duplicate to create an image containing just the contents of the selection, then export to a tab delimited, excelcompatible text file using filesave astext imagej. The way of partitioning the cover image into twopixel blocks runs through all the rows of each image in a zigzag manner, as shown in fig. This plugin allows you to save images opened in fiji directly to the hdf5 format preferred by ilastik. I have so far tried to get pixel values my image has 262144 pixels as seen in the two lowest lines. Microsoft excel is a powerful spreadsheet application, but it also allows for the creation of a wide variety of impressive charts and graphs.
This command does not alter pixel values as long as normalize. Capturing plugin captures images on windows using jmf webcam capture. It provides free, open source tools for trabecular geometry and whole bone shape analysis. This is called the rgba color space having the red, green, blue. The cover images used in the proposed method are 256 grayvalued ones.
In the intro to imagej section, you learned that a digital image is a string of numbers, displayed in a rectangular array, according to a lookup table. Presumably the data in the histogram exists somewhere as a 256,1 32 bit array. To install it, you have to download its jar file and drop it in the plugins folder of fiji. In case of color image, it returns three values which are red, green, blue. Extracting pixel values of an image in python hackerearth. The arrow keys nudge the red square if the pixel values window is in the foreground. This problem can arise when 12bit, 14bit or 16bit images are loaded into imagej without autoscaling.
You need to call getrgb method of the bufferedimage class to get the value of the pixel. This allows one to copy the spatial calibration from one stack to another. Note that some image file formats use compression algorithms that may reduce the pixel resolution or dynamic range of an images intensity values. An action called export current spots to ij rois will appear in the menu of the action panel the very last one in the gui. These values are clipped when image is applied and outputs of. You can read the image data and save in excel with the following commands. Pixels should now be an array of pixel values, but its an object that i cant access as an array.
The method getrgb takes the row and column index as a parameter and returns the appropriate pixel. Some file formats are suitable for data to analyze, others for data only to display. I would like to export all the grayscale value from a picture or from a stack of images and wanted to process in excel and. The submenu contains a selection of color lookup tables that can be applied to grayscale images to produce falsecolor images. In java, the bufferedimage class is used to handle images. What it does is display, in a window, the values of the pixels in a small square neighborhood outlined in red as the mouse is dragged over the image. Using pixelvalue image, ppos, type returns a pixel value in the range.
In that case, the display is scaled to the full 16bit range 0 65535 intensity values, even though the actual data values typically span a much smaller range. I get that the pixel is 0 which seems to be an out of bounds return value, and that the pixelvalue is 1024. Hello, i want to export the image pixel values in a 2d dimensions array. You can also import a text image, i use that frequently when i use mathematical software to do computations on an image. The tool also allows the user to export the pixel values for more than one map at. Mar 28, 2015 using imagej you can export any image as text image, you then get a text file that contains the grey values of the pixels. The pixel values might also be compressed which could be an even bigger problem. An image contains a two dimensional array of pixels. Introduction to scientific image processing with fijiimagej. Java dip image pixels an image contains a two dimensional array of pixels.
If you encounter bugs, please see the getting help page. Experimental release bonej2 theres a new modernized version of bonej available through the imagej updater. How to export excel charts as image files tekrevue. Glioblastoma images color block and boundary data can also be downloaded.
See the source code page for details on obtaining the imagej. To export the measurements as a tabdelimited text file. Spine can export a single image, sequence of images, video, and json or binary data. Imagej is a javabased image processing program developed at the national institutes of. After running a filter, it displays the elapsed time and processing rate in. That is a table of pixel values where the position in the table corresponds to the position of the pixel in the image. The xaxis represents the possible gray values and the yaxis shows the number of pixels found for each gray value. Is there plugin available to export each pixel intensity value roi a matrix to a txt file or excel file. While writing the pixel values is trivial, the recreation of the image requires the dimensions also. Imagej displays images by linearly mapping pixel values in the display range to display. Posted on august 27, 20 february 28, 2017 by akshay pai. Bonej is a plugin for bone image analysis in imagej. After you save the file and process it with ilastik, you can use the same plugin to load the results for further postprocessing in fiji.
Export pixel values software free download export pixel. Extracting pixel values of an image in python source dexter. This filter uses convolution with a gaussian function for smoothing. Download the image to your week 2 folder and use the techniques you learned here to set a scale for the image. I wanted to extract each pixel values so that i can use them for locating simple objects in an image. This page is concerned solely with linear changes in pixel values to enhance. Note that some image file formats use compression algorithms that may reduce the pixel resolution or. The power of image processing is its ability to make measurements in these dimensions. Other options for saving and exporting image files are shown in the fiji save as menu. The pixel data can then be retrieved by indexing the pixel map as an array. Pixel values reflectance of the image didnt confine between 0 and 1 and were about. Some images can be downloaded with expression or projection data. Writes to a text file the xy coordinates and pixel value of all nonbackground pixels in the active image. Here are several ways to export an excel chart as an image.
Use imagevalue to extract interpolated values at x, y in the standard image coordinate system. Every image is made up of pixels and when these values are extracted using python, four values are obtained for each pixel r, g, b, a. This is called the rgba color space having the red, green, blue colors and alpha value respectively. For example, the water has a wide range of pixel values, as do the islands themselves. In the simplest case of binary images, the pixel value is a 1bit number indicating either foreground or background. To export an image to an asset in your earth engine assets folder, use export. To determine the values of one or more pixels in an image and return the values in a variable, use the impixel function. With pixelvalue image, marker, nonzero pixels of the image marker are used as the list of positions. The value of a pixel at any point correspond to the intensity of the light photons striking at that point. Introduction to scientific image processing with fiji. Generating a text matrix with pixel values imagemagick.
Pixel export jmars java missionplanning and analysis for. Pixel export jmars java missionplanning and analysis. Apr 06, 2016 you can read the image data and save in excel with the following commands. Setting the maximum memory value to more than about 75% of real. This will both be faster and allow you to export the image in a pixelperfect way. This option saves each slice in a stack as a separate tif file. And you did not specify the format of the txt file. It will convert each spot to a point in the multipoint roi. Width and height specify the image dimensions in pixels.
When saving in raw format, littleendian byte order is used if export raw in intel byte order is. For rgb images, there will be three numbers, red, green and blue. Unless, perhaps, that person was the designer of the bmp format. Calculates and displays a histogram of the distribution of gray values in the active image or selection. Applies the current lookup table function to each pixel in the image or selection and restores the default identity function. How labeler apps store exported pixel labels matlab. The tool also allows the user to export the pixel values for more than one map at a time as long as the ppd is the same for each map. Pixelvalue image, ppos by default returns values between 0 and 1. If we just want to extract the islands themselves, we need to push all pixel values into just two bins to make the image black and white. In other words, in the proposed data embedding process, we adjust the gray values in each two pixel pair by two new ones whose difference value causes changes unnoticeable to an observer of the stego image.
Python imaging libraryediting pixels wikibooks, open. More than 100 additional lookup tables are available at. If the pixel values window is in the foreground, pressing c or ctrlc copies the current table of pixel values into the clipboard tabdelimited. I want to calculate the pixel values of an image and. Nov 22, 2001 this plugin copies the pixel size from the calibration of one image or stack to a second image or stack. You can specify the pixels by passing their coordinates as input arguments or you can select the pixels interactively using a mouse. I want to calculate the pixel values of an image and export. However, there is a fairly good chance your image will be converted to 8bit andor rgb color, extra dimensions will be thrown away leaving you with a 2d image only and most metadata lost.
This repository contains imagej2 plugins that wrap ilastik workflows for usage in imagej and knime. It is actually the value of those pixels that make up an image. The value range defines the minimum and maximum of the image you want to export. Each pixel store a value proportional to the light intensity at that particular. Each of the pixels that represents an image stored inside a computer has a pixel value which describes how bright that pixel is, andor what color it should be.
That means that you do not have to run an installer. I have a small image and i want to display each pixel value on the image in imagej instead of pointing each pixel and look at the value one by one. To export the measurements as a tabdelimited text file, select filesave. While this conversion is beneficial for any large dataset, we especially recommend it for multipage tiffs. Exports the measurements as a tabdelimited or commadelimited text file as. How to save pixel values of an image in excel file in. For a grayscale images, the pixel value is a single number that represents the brightness of the pixel. Exports the xy coordinates of the active roi as a two column.
Dicom import and export uses dcm4che library watershed. I thought it might be best to see if someone would look at a small segment of the code and comment. Set slices to a value greater than one to create a stack. This plugin copies the pixel size from the calibration of one image or stack to a second image or stack. While sharing an entire excel file is often preferable, sometimes you may wish to only share or export the graph or chart. The following example illustrates exporting portions of a landsat image using different pyramiding policies for the same band. Imagej can calculate area and pixel value statistics of userdefined selections. Pixel export is a tool that allows you to export the pixel values under a line, point or polygon for the map of your choice into a csv file. Nov 02, 2012 you forgot to mention, if you have imported the jpg already. Every image is made up of pixels and when these values are extracted using python, four values are obtained for each pixel r,g,b,a. In an 8bit gray scale image, the value of the pixel between 0 and 255. You will be presented with the option to either name the images numerically or with the slice labels.
The following exports the previously generated image with the default value of imageresolution, which is 72 dpi. Lookup tables in the imagejluts folder are added to the imagelookup tables menu, below the built in ones. The status bar, when the cursor is over an image, displays pixel coordinates and values. This modifies the gray values so that when the image is viewed using the default grayscale lookup table it will look the same as it did before. Use imageduplicate to create an image containing just the contents of the selection, then export to a tab delimited, excelcompatible text file using filesave astext imagej. You may download this program from the source or copy. Select the matrix spreed sheet and then import the tiff image. Hello, anyone know how to extract the values of the pixels of an image having a list of coordinates in utm or a point file in shp in erdas imagine 2014. The total pixel count is also calculated and displayed, as well as the mean, modal, minimum and maximum gray value. It is not wellcompressed like jpeg or png, and nor does it contain much of the. Open and save allow importing or exporting the luts. Save your image with your scale bar added, if it did not originally have one, to your week 2 folder. In part b of the dialog the value range of the image must be specified.
Selecting uncalibrated od from the popup menu causes imagej to convert gray values to uncalibrated optical density values using the function. This means that you jpg file will have 10017272 dpi 100 horizontal pixels. Many common questions are answered on the faq and troubleshooting pages. I would like to generate a text file with the pixel colors or preferred grayscale intensities in a matrix corresponding to the pixel positions. How to save pixel values of an image in excel file in matlab. Imagej reading values from a histogram within imagej.
Using imagej you can export any image as text image, you then get a text file that contains the grey values of the pixels. The image download service serves whole and partial twodimensional images presented on the allen brain atlas web site. Data transfer is managed through temporary hdf5 file exportimport, which can also be performed individually. When the appli is running, it crash when the array ger arounf 00 value. It can calculate area and pixel value statistics of userdefined selections. I have tried to save the image as a text file, but it is very hard working to find and collect the pixels i am interested in. Like all imagej convolution operations, it assumes that outofimage pixels have a value. I am struggling to extract individual pixel values from a selection or area of interest using imagej.
634 218 1179 1106 949 1281 204 1386 584 945 490 573 1368 1439 799 682 1016 883 222 1492 645 758 907 510 730 1380 488 1205 205 1406